In the nameless valley, not long after Alan temporarily settled down, various abnormalities began to appear.
Sometimes the earth shook violently, as if there was a sudden earthquake, and sometimes there were strong winds, thunder, and rain covering the whole area for a long time.
The creatures that originally lived in it fled out of instinctive fear. Even the plants that struggled to grow and were scattered on the exposed rock layers became withered and gradually died in this ever-changing and harsh climate.
Deep in the valley, the bear goblin saint was now naked, sitting cross-legged on a huge rock, his ferocious male organs and strong muscles were completely exposed to the air, but there was not a trace of vulgarity.
If you look closely, you can see the muscles hidden under the thick hair moving in an orderly manner, and drops of sweat and white steam being squeezed out from the skin, either dripping onto the rocks along the hair or drifting into the air.
"Humph!!!"
Alan's brows suddenly tightened into a "川" shape, and he couldn't help but let out a low groan. Then he suddenly punched the air with his big hands. The wind from his fists created a violent gust of wind that whistled across the valley walls and rolled up countless dust.
Along with the fist wind, a part of Alan's mental power that he had actively cut off and abandoned was also thrown out of the body. After the mental power carrying the huge and complicated thoughts left its owner, it turned back into natural energy. However, before it could dissipate, it produced some kind of chemical reaction with the wills of countless creatures, connecting with the magic of nature to form dark clouds above the valley.
Click! ! !
A torrential rain mixed with hail fell in an instant, washing over the valley. Colorful mists emerged from it. Various sounds and illusions from the mundane world rose and fell in the valley, and occasionally pictures flashed between the sky, water and clouds.
The charming, violent, humble, and fearful voices kept circling in Alan's ears and mind, trying to influence and pollute the spiritual world of the bear goblin.
But how could Alan let them do as they wished?
The divine power flowing in the body turned into balls of golden divine fire, which continuously tempered every cell in the body as the blood flowed. Fortunately, Alan had already completed the energyization of his body, otherwise the pain brought by the constant tempering of the flesh by the divine fire would be enough to make a person collapse.
The body expanded and contracted during the tempering, distorting Alan's body and face. Sometimes his abdomen swelled like a balloon, and sometimes his muscles withered like a mummy.
The divine fire turned all the way in, and even directly transformed into a form in the sea of consciousness. Endless mental power evaporated and formed clouds under the burning of the divine fire, and then condensed into raindrops in the sky and fell down. This cycle repeated itself just to eliminate the pollution of Allen's body by external will.
Turbulent waves were surging in the sea of consciousness, and Alan's main consciousness was like a small boat drifting in the wind. If he was not careful, the violent turbulence would tear his ego into countless pieces, and he would become an idiot.
The mayfly-like filaments of spiritual power were sublimated in the divine fire, becoming more tenacious and purer. Even the color that appeared was dyed by the divine fire, emitting a faint golden charm in Alan's perception.
A large amount of impurities left over from the divine fire quenching were eventually woven into a sponge by Allen with his divinely infected mental hairpins, and then he cut off the heavy mental hairpins with a sharp blade transformed by his tenacious will and divine power. At the same time, the divine fire quickly wrapped and burned them and expelled them from his body. The physical and mental pain was beyond words, and only a tough and patient person like Allen could act so calmly, but he couldn't help but groan.
…………
Several days and nights passed with the sun rising and the moon setting. An adventurer passing by once felt the unusual scene here and thought that something strange was happening, so he bravely broke into the foggy valley, but soon ran out in panic, leaving here without looking back.
But even after leaving the fog, these adventurers could not feel safe. There were always all kinds of inexplicable noises ringing in their ears and minds. The world before their eyes became real and fake, making it difficult for them to distinguish reality. Even seeking divine treatment from the temple priests was of no avail, and they eventually went mad and died.
The fog contained a huge amount of energy including the power of faith, the spiritual power of saints comparable to that of gods, and divine power. Even if a legendary warrior had the physical and mental strength to enter this fog, it would be difficult to escape unscathed, let alone an ordinary adventurer.
This fog is now like a mental virus, devouring the surrounding natural energy to maintain its own existence, while silently infecting any creature that enters it.
Perhaps it won't be long before this place will become another forbidden place for adventurers that makes people shudder. Or maybe after Alan leaves this place, these dangerous energies will lose their source and dissipate. Who knows?
Alan didn't know about the changes that were taking place in this nameless valley. Even if he knew, he wouldn't care too much. As long as it didn't expand and endanger the natural ecology of the North, having such a Jedi might not be a bad thing.
After tempering himself several times and cutting off nearly 1/20 of his mental power, Allen painfully stopped the action. He couldn't tell if there was any messy energy left in his body, nor did he know if his temperament had changed. After all, as the master, personality is the most difficult thing to feel.
However, he was very sure that his current actions would at least delay his transformation into a ruthless and indifferent god, because he could feel that his emotions were already fluctuating in his heart.
The painful and difficult training finally made the tireless Allen feel a little tired. Now he just wanted to return to the barracks and have a good sleep.
This faint feeling of wanting to relax just rose from the depths of his mind, and was almost suppressed by Alan's strong and resolute will. Fortunately, what Alan cared about most at this time was the needs and changes in his heart. He immediately noticed and made a quick decision: then indulge yourself, go back and have a good sleep, and give yourself a holiday! !
He no longer worried about the emergence of this emotion and the decision he made, whether it was out of his own heart or he was kidnapped by the desires of his believers. Alan took out a set of coarse cotton and linen clothes, put them on in a few seconds, and flew towards the Thorn Fortress he had been traveling to and from.
As he flew, Alan's brain began to think unconsciously: How much did the Northern Alliance lose in this siege? How much did the elves lose? Are the reinforcements from their kingdom on their way out? How big is their number...
Alan, who has a hard-working life, is still unable to completely relax!
